9600x + 16GBx2 or 9800x3d + 16GBx1 by No_Goat1733 in IndianPCGamers

[–]W1ndows_XP 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Get 32 gigs. its the sweet spot. I have 9600x and 32GB CL36 6000MHZ. I am usually crossing 16GB when playing games and its good to have headroom to open other things. 

You can upgrade cpu later. Ram is a gamble.

Regardinggpu, consider rx9070xt  if all you want to do is game. Sure you lose on some good Nvidia features but you get close performance and way better bang for your buck. 

I got the non xt version to keep the build under 1.7L

pc restarting even after using a ups by kryt0x_ in IndianGaming

[–]W1ndows_XP 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Either get a pure sinewave ups or a ups with high VA I have 9600x/rx9070/750WGL psu with cyberpower 2200VA And it can handle power cuts without restarting.

I suspect that your ups cant provide the amount of power you psu requires during Gaming cutoff
